Abstract:
A silica gel which carries a titanium oxide photocatalyst in high concentration, characterized in that it has an average micropore diameter of 6 to 100 nm and it has a gradient of titanium oxide concentration such that a titanium oxide content of a micropore located in the vicinity of the surface of a silica gel particle is 7 to 70 wt % and is no less than 1.5 times that of a micropore located in the vicinity of the central portion of the particle; and a method for preparing the same. The silica gel has a gradient of titanium oxide concentration wherein a titanium oxide content is higher in the vicinity of the surface of a particle and lower in a central part thereof, which results in the improvement of the ability to decompose environmental pollutants or the like such as a malodorous or hazardous substance contained in air, an organic solvent contained in water and an agricultural chemical, and also has various excellent characteristics from view points of safety, economy, stability and resistance to water (no crack when placed in water).
